Jack Grealish has responded to criticism from Graeme Souness, who accused him of holding onto the ball for too long during his time at Aston Villa. Grealish, who is now one of the best players in the Premier League after joining Manchester City, said that the criticism still frustrates him. He explained that as a key player at Villa, he was often tasked with dictating play and keeping possession, and that Souness’s comments did not take into account the team’s tactics. Grealish added that he no longer pays attention to critics when he has played badly, but will watch and listen to commentary when he has played well.
